Despite Cynthia Bailey getting physical with Porsha Wiliams this season on Bravo’s The Real Housewives of Atlanta, Williams said she can relate to the model turned reality star.

We saw Bailey’s marital woes play out on the show’s eighth season opener Sunday. Her husband, Peter Thomas, was caught red-handed (via a video that went viral) kissing and fondling another woman. Bailey confronted Thomas, who didn’t think he did anything wrong at first.

Well now, Williams is pointing out that she has gone through similar moments on national TV.

Williams told Bravo TV earlier this week, “I honestly felt sorry for Cynthia and saw myself in her. I too have been in a relationship and operated in total denial, and that’s what I thought she was doing. It’s just easier sometimes to put your head down, run your business and keep the peace.”

Williams also spoke on another much talked about moment on the show: Kenya Moore and Sheree Whitfield going head-to-head after Moore blasted Whitfield’s home she is building.

“I felt like Kenya had touched on a very sensitive subject and that it was disrespectful to gossip about Sheree’s business.”

She added that Moore doesn’t have much room to talk about anyone’s home as the foreclosed home she purchased in the same neighborhood was Whitfield’s and was pretty torn down itself.

“At least if I am going to talk about someone, I would like to be in a better position than them. Who are we to judge how long it should take for a house to be done? At the end of the day at least she does own it, whether she is in it or not!”
